Top 4 Ideas You Can Try to Refresh Your Home

Are you feeling like your home needs a refresh? It’s totally normal to feel this way after living in the same space for a while. Sometimes all it takes is a few small changes to make everything feel new again. Here are four ideas you can try to get started!

Upgrade Your Flooring 

One large investment that you can make that will make your home look modern and more beautiful is to upgrade the thing you’re standing on. Many people nowadays use stained interior concrete floors to replace the old models which can give a much more updated appearance to the home. Not only is this change trendy, but it will also last you many years without as much need for upkeep and maintenance.

Making this switch is a great way to make your home feel new, but it doesn’t stop there! You can also consider upgrading the flooring in other areas of your house such as the kitchen, bedrooms, and bathrooms. This will give each room its own unique look that you can style to fit your personal preferences.

When upgrading flooring, be sure to think about what type of material would work best for each individual space. If you have children or pets, for example, you’ll want something that is durable and easy to clean. Laminate and hardwood are both good options for high-traffic areas, while tile or marble might be better choices for spaces with less wear and tear. No matter what you choose, upgrading your flooring is a great way to give your home a fresh start!

Repaint The Walls 

A small job that can do miracles when it comes to refreshing your home is repainting the walls. Choose a color that will make your space feel new and energized. If you’re feeling daring, go for a bold color that will make a statement. If you’re more conservative, stick to neutrals or pastels. Either way, repainting the walls can completely change the look and feel of your home.

To do this job well, you’ll need to prepare the walls. Make sure that they are clean and free of any dirt or debris. If you have any holes or cracks in the wall, you’ll need to fix them before painting. Once the walls are ready, it’s time to start painting!

Use a roller brush for large areas and a paintbrush for smaller areas. Start at the top of the wall and work your way down. Be careful not to drip paint on your floor or furniture. Let the paint dry completely before moving on to the next room.

Repainting your walls is an easy way to give your home a fresh new look, without breaking the bank! 

Fix Up The Outdoors 

There are a lot of things that you can do to fix up the outdoors and make it more inviting. This can be a great way to refresh your home without spending too much money. Here are some ideas to get you started:

  • Add plants or flowers to your yard or garden. Not only will this add color, but it will also help to improve air quality.
  • Install a new patio or deck. This can really enhance the look of your outdoor space and provide a place to relax or entertain guests.
  • Upgrade your fencing or gates. A nice fence or gate can add style and security to your property.
  • Invest in outdoor lighting. Properly lit spaces can be cozy and inviting after dark.
  • These are just a few ideas to get you started. There are plenty of other things that you can do to fix up the outdoors and refresh your home. Be creative and have fun with it!

Once this job is done, it’s important to maintain it so that it continues to look great. You’ll need to weed the garden, trim the lawn, and clean up any debris on a regular basis. This may seem like a lot of work, but it’s definitely worth it in the end.

Upgrade The Furniture 

Furniture adds a lot to the feel of a home, and it can be fun to upgrade the furniture every once in a while to give your home a new look. You can either go for an entirely new style of furniture or simply replace some pieces that you don’t like as much. If you’re on a budget, consider refinishing or repainting old furniture instead of buying new pieces.

Modernizing your chairs and tables is a great way to give your home a quick refresh. If you have wood furniture, consider staining or painting it a new color. You can also add new hardware or accents to update the look of your furniture without spending too much money.

Also, Rearranging your furniture can make your home feel like a completely different space.
